The reindex job for Quartzfeather kicks off at 02:10 and normally completes within forty minutes. If it runs past 03:30, check the shard allocator on the Marlowe cluster before restarting anything — a mid-flight restart can orphan the staging alias and leave stale results serving until morning. Confirm document counts match yesterday's snapshot within 0.5% before swapping aliases. If counts diverge, page the data platform rotation rather than forcing the swap. Record the trace token from the final job log line here.

pipeline stamp: htk9_ce63042d9

## Handover — notification fan-out

Handing off the Pushwren fan-out work. The backpressure valve is now active: when downstream ack latency exceeds 800ms, the dispatcher sheds low-priority notifications rather than queueing indefinitely. Watch the shed-rate dashboard; anything above 2% sustained warrants paging me. Do not raise the worker count without also raising the broker quota. Current production configuration is listed below.

deployment values, taweg-bajop:
[fenvan]
port = 5672
team = holmir
host = fenvan.orvexio.example
region = lower-1
access_code = ac_b98bc6
timeout_ms = 1500

# Tax-Rate Lookup Cache — Contacts

The Ledgerling rate cache sits in front of the jurisdiction service. TTL is 6 hours; invalidations are event-driven from the rates feed. Stale-rate incidents: page the billing on-call, not the cache owners. Schema or TTL changes need sign-off from the Brindlemoor compliance pod. Cache-miss storms and warmer failures go to the platform caching team. For everything else, including access requests, use the team inbox.

alerts address for bafog-tawep: ulavan_sorwyn_fraax@kelviworks.local

Capacity note for the Skylark crash-report pipeline: volume from the Petrel mobile release doubled ingest to roughly 9k reports/minute at peak, and the dedup stage is now the bottleneck. Support should expect delayed symbolication during release weeks until we add a third worker pool. The queue and batching constants currently in effect appear below.

tuning table, faduf-baduf:
PRIORITIES = {
    "ulavan": 191,
    "silys": 750,
    "goriel": 238,
    "kelmir": 66,
    "wendor": 432,
}